I’m trying to get FFT running “bare metal”. I’m tring to see if I can build an RF spectrum analyser that can do a 1024 bin FFT at a 1MHz sample rate anywhere in a band from 50MHz to 500MHz.

Would also like to do Software Defined Radio. Although it would be nice to do this on MF, I don’t know if there will be enough CPU time for the RLP tasks, never mind MF. And this will be a hard realtime application. It will have to process 9.6MB/s through a 1024 bin FFT for the spectrum analyser, or 9.6MB/s through a down sampling FIR filter to get 400KB/s which must then be FM demodulated in software…
